Construction & real estate›💡Electronic & Electrical›🍎Food & Beverages›🛋️Home furnishing & supplies›⚗️Industrial goods & chemical›🪨Minerals & metals›📦Miscellaneous›E-silk Route Ventures Pvt. Ltd. supplies whole cloves sourced from Sri Lankan growing regions, known for smaller, denser buds with a high oil yield. The product is delivered as unbroken, dried flower buds, typically 10 to 13 millimetres in length, with a deep reddish-brown hue and a moisture content under 11 percent. These cloves are selected for their intense aroma and low broken-particle rate, distinguishing them from larger Indonesian varieties.
The supplier claims organic sourcing but does not provide certification numbers or lab validation. Sri Lankan cloves are traditionally grown with minimal synthetic inputs, aligning with organic practices in many smallholder farms. Packaging is in food-grade polypropylene bags, sealed with heat and labelled with batch codes. The absence of a certified organic label means buyers must independently verify claims through third-party testing.
These cloves are commonly used in bakery spice mixes, meat curing, and Ayurvedic formulations, with demand from health food brands and artisanal food producers in North America and Europe. Buyers seek them for their smaller size and concentrated flavour, ideal for fine grinding. Trade terms are negotiable; standard export packaging and FOB Colombo shipping are typical, though payment methods are not specified in the listing.

Before ordering, request proof of origin documentation from Sri Lankan customs or the Ministry of Agriculture. Confirm the cloves were harvested in Sri Lanka and not re-exported from another country. Ask for a recent batch test report showing moisture, essential oil, and aflatoxin levels. Do not accept supplier claims without lab validation from an accredited third party.
Confirm the Incoterms - FOB Colombo or CIF - is clearly defined in the contract. Lead time from Sri Lanka typically ranges from 20 to 35 days, depending on vessel availability. Payment terms are not stated; buyers must request whether T/T, L/C, or D/P are accepted. Always require a detailed packing list matching the invoice weight and bag count before payment.
Upon arrival, inspect at least 5 percent of the bags for colour, odour, and moisture. Use a hygrometer to check internal humidity and a sieve to verify broken percentage. Retain a 500-gram sample from each batch for 12 months. Request a phytosanitary certificate and health certificate from Sri Lankan authorities. Discrepancies in quality must be reported within 14 days of unloading.
